### Retrying Failed Exports

Hey, new folks — exports from the Mistral dashboard fail more often than we'd like, usually on oversized date ranges. First move: shrink the range and hit retry in the Coppervale queue. If the retry button is greyed out, the export worker's credential store has locked itself. You can unlock it yourself; just enter the recovery passphrase shown below.

vault phrase of tajop-haduf = holath-brivan-wenax

## Deploying the Gatewick Proctor Queue

Deploys are pretty painless: push to main, wait for the pipeline, then watch the queue drain dashboard for five minutes. If candidates pile up mid-exam, roll back first and ask questions later — the queue replays safely. Everything the workers care about lives in one config block, shown here for reference.

settings of bafof-yagef:
JOROX_PIN=8740
JOROX_TENANT=pelox
JOROX_METRICS_HOST=metrics.jorox.qorvelworks.internal
JOROX_SEAL=seal_c78f63c1
JOROX_STANDBY_TEAM=norax

## Landlord Site Audit — Reception Notes

On Thursday next week, auditors from Bramfield Estates, the landlord for Corvette Wharf, will inspect all access points in the building. Reception staff must log each auditor on arrival, check photo identification against the list supplied by Tomas Areli, and issue orange visitor lanyards only. Auditors may not enter the server corridor unescorted under any circumstances. Should they need to verify the riser room on Level 2, accompany them personally and use the access code below.

turnstile pass: bdg-TXR-4

Subject: DR Drill Prep — Scrollkeep Audit-Log Viewer

Hi on-call,

Next Tuesday's disaster-recovery drill fails over the Scrollkeep audit-log viewer to the Dunmere standby cluster. Your part: once failover is announced, confirm the viewer loads, spot-check three recent log entries against the primary snapshot, and verify retention filters still apply. Expect roughly ten minutes of read-only degradation. The standby instance boots sealed, so you will need to unseal it before any checks; the unseal screen asks for the passphrase provided below.

vault phrase of taguf-taguf = ralath-briwyn